About
As the world’s largest manufacturer of clean technologies, data on China’s cleantech exports provide an important early insight into the pace and scale of the energy transition. In 2024, China produced around 80% of the world’s solar PV modules and battery cells, and 70% of electric vehicles.
This tool allows users to compare exports of different technologies to a specific country or region in both a monthly format and a yearly view. It also compares technology exports to different countries.
This dataset is uniquely powerful in providing detailed data at a country level, with a time lag of just a few weeks. The underlying data is aggregated into specific technology categories for visualisation in the data tool. The full data download includes a breakdown of the export value of individual commodity codes, and groups them by additional sub-categories.

Methodology
Efforts have been made to capture export values of clean technologies as precisely as possible. In reality, export values would be larger if you included the additional parts and raw materials that form part of the wider clean tech value chain.
